Related problems and solutions

One of the most common problems related to dog training for biting near me is aggressive behavior. Aggressive behavior can be caused by fear, anxiety, or territorial instincts. It is essential to identify the cause of the aggression and to address it appropriately. Some solutions include socialization, obedience training, and positive reinforcement. Another problem is mouthing and nipping. Puppies tend to mouth and nip as a form of play, but it can be painful and dangerous when they grow up. Solutions for this problem include redirecting their attention, providing chew toys, and teaching them commands such as "leave it" or "drop it."

Frequently asked questions

Q: How long does it take to train a dog to stop biting? A: The training duration varies depending on the dog's age, breed, and behavior. It can take several weeks to several months to train a dog to stop biting. Q: Can I train my dog to stop biting on my own? A: Yes, you can train your dog to stop biting on your own. However, it is recommended to seek professional help if your dog has aggressive behavior or if you are not experienced in dog training. Q: Is punishment an effective method for stopping biting? A: No, punishment is not an effective method for stopping biting. It can increase fear and anxiety in dogs, leading to more aggressive behavior.

Tips for dog training for biting near me

1. Socialization: Socializing your dog from a young age can prevent aggression and biting behavior. 2. Positive reinforcement: Reward your dog for good behavior with treats, toys, and praise. This will encourage them to behave well. 3. Obedience training: Teach your dog basic commands such as "sit," "stay," and "come." This will help them to obey your commands and control their behavior. 4. Redirection: Redirect your dog's attention when they start biting. Offer them a toy or treat to chew on instead. 5. Consistency: Be consistent in your training approach and commands. This will help your dog to understand what is expected of them.
